  1. Yamaha YZF R15

If you seek a bike that exceeds daily commuting needs, the Yamaha YZF R15, with its 155cc engine, is a top choice in India. It boasts 18.3 BHP and 14.1 Nm torque and delivers a reliable 40 km/l mileage.

  • Suzuki Gixxer

The Suzuki Gixxer, weighing 135 kg, stands out among 150cc bikes with a commendable mileage of 40-54 km/l. The 154.9cc engine generates 14.8 BHP and 14 Nm torque, providing a lightweight, manoeuvrable ride.

  • Suzuki Intruder 150

The Suzuki Intruder 150 offers a potent 154.9cc engine, producing 14.8 BHP and 14 Nm torque, ensuring a charming and powerful ride.

  • Hero Xtreme Sports

The Hero Xtreme Sports balances power and fuel efficiency, boasting a 149.2cc engine delivering 15.82 BHP and 13.5 Nm torque.

  • Yamaha YZF FZS

The Yamaha YZF FZS impresses with remarkable road grip and control, powered by a 149cc air-cooled engine producing 13.2 BHP and 12.8 Nm torque.

  • Yamaha SZ-RR

The Yamaha SZ-RR is a reliable and reasonably priced daily commute option with a 149cc engine and a mileage ranging from 45–50 km/l.

  • Bajaj V15

The Bajaj V15 stands out with superb mileage ranging from 57 to 60 kmpl, making it one of India’s top 150cc bikes. Its 149cc engine delivers 12 BHP and 12.7 Nm torque, ensuring a powerful yet efficient ride.

  • Bajaj Pulsar

Renowned for reliability, the Bajaj Pulsar offers various variants catering to diverse consumer needs, making it suitable for beginners.

  • Hero Achiever

Featuring i3S technology for fuel efficiency, the Hero Achiever’s 149.1cc engine provides 13.4 BHP power and 12.8 Nm torque.

  1. Yamaha XSR155

Yamaha introduces the XSR155 to its racing bike lineup, alongside the FZS and R15. Anticipate a liquid-cooled 155cc engine with an expected power of 19.3BHP, 14.7Nm torque, and an estimated mileage of 48.75 kmpl.
